The computation of the official unemployment rate is shown below:

Official unemployment rate is

= Unemployed workers ÷ (Unemployed + employed) × 100

= 13,863,000 ÷ (13,863,000 + 139,323,000) × 100

= 9.05%

Now for the U-4 is

= (Unemployed workers + discouraged workers) ÷ (Unemployed + employed + discouraged workers) × 100

= (13,863,000 + $993,000) ÷ (13,863,000 + 139,323,000 + $993,000) × 100

= 9.64%

Therefore for exclduing the discouraged workers it may cause the offical rate to understate the underemployment true extent
